Regulatory frameworks across multiple jurisdictions set precise parameters for randomizer calibration whenever operators combine slot machine algorithms with live roulette feeds and layered bonus systems, and these rules often require synchronized testing protocols that account for cross-game interactions. Licensing bodies in places like Nevada and Ontario mandate independent audits of random number generators before any merged platform receives approval, while the calibration process must demonstrate consistent probability distributions even when bonus multipliers activate during live wheel spins.

Regulatory Requirements for Merged Systems

State and provincial authorities require that randomizers in hybrid platforms maintain separate seed values for reel-based games and wheel-based outcomes yet still pass joint integrity checks, and this dual-layer verification becomes essential when tiered bonuses link player progress across both formats. Data from licensing submissions in 2025 showed that platforms merging these elements underwent an average of 47 distinct calibration tests per jurisdiction before deployment, with particular scrutiny applied to sequences where a slot-triggered bonus influences subsequent roulette wagers.

Observers note that licensing standards frequently specify minimum return-to-player percentages that must hold steady across the entire ecosystem, including when promotional credits from higher bonus tiers alter effective volatility, and regulators in Australia’s Northern Territory have published guidelines requiring operators to submit simulation data covering at least 10 million combined game cycles. These requirements push developers to adjust internal weighting tables so that live roulette randomizers do not inherit bias from concurrent slot reel outcomes.

Calibration Techniques Under Licensing Oversight

Engineers calibrate randomizers by mapping each game’s probability space and then running cross-validation routines that simulate bonus tier advancements, and licensing documents indicate that any deviation exceeding 0.02 percent in expected value triggers mandatory recalibration. Platforms operating in multiple markets must satisfy the strictest standard among them, which often means applying the most conservative entropy thresholds used by any single regulator.

Testing laboratories accredited by bodies such as the Alcohol and Gaming Commission of Ontario perform hardware and software evaluations that include live dealer synchronization checks, and these evaluations measure latency between reel stops and wheel spins when bonus features bridge the two. Figures released in regulatory reports show that hybrid platforms approved after August 2025 averaged 12 percent longer certification timelines compared with standalone slot or roulette products, largely because of the added complexity of tracking tier progression across game types.

Impact of Tiered Bonus Structures on Randomizer Settings

Tiered bonus systems introduce variable payout multipliers that licensing rules treat as extensions of the core randomizer, requiring operators to prove that higher tiers do not create unintended clustering of favorable outcomes in either slots or live roulette. Jurisdictions in New Jersey and several European markets now demand that bonus calibration reports include Monte Carlo simulations covering every possible tier transition path, and these reports must demonstrate statistical independence between the base game randomizers and the bonus award mechanisms.

Industry reports from the European Gaming and Betting Association highlight that platforms failing to isolate bonus randomizers from primary game seeds have faced delayed approvals or mandated code revisions, while compliant systems display stable distribution curves regardless of which tier a player occupies. Licensing standards in these regions also stipulate ongoing monitoring, with operators required to submit quarterly variance reports that flag any statistical drift in combined reel-wheel sessions.

Cross-Jurisdictional Challenges and August 2026 Developments

Operators expanding across borders encounter differing calibration tolerances, and some licensing authorities have begun requiring unified randomizer documentation that references all active jurisdictions simultaneously. Updates scheduled for August 2026 in several North American markets will introduce new entropy minimums for hybrid platforms, forcing recalibration of existing systems that merge slot mechanics with live roulette feeds under tiered reward structures.

Those who have reviewed draft regulations note that the forthcoming standards emphasize verifiable separation between promotional credit randomizers and core game randomizers, a distinction that affects how bonus tiers interact with both digital reels and physical wheel outcomes. Compliance teams at major platforms have already begun preliminary testing cycles to meet the August timeline, according to filings submitted to state gaming boards.
